Yesterday, we took a little field trip to see a cheese maker it was out at Point Reyes, The Cowgirl Creamery. Great cheese and great business owners. They actually make vegetarian cheese by using a vegetarian rennet which is very rare. Not that the rennet is rare - just rare that a cheese maker is using a vegetarian rennet.
That is another thing you learn a whole lot about food that maybe you really didn't want to know. Like did you know that all, and I mean all sugar is put through a filtration process that involves bones? White, raw, all browns kind of crazy -oh, and that all brown was white and then sprayed with molasses it is easier and cheaper to just process all sugar at once then go back and make some into brown and light brown sugar.
